The image, legit or not, refers to a biblical reference from the book of Revelation (ie= the Apocalypse). After God has finally done away with the Devil and has tossed all the wicked souls into the lake of fire (ala Smiley Face?), he builds a New Jerusalem (Heaven) where he and the worthy will live in peace and harmony forever. The city is described as having 12 gates through which only the worthy can enter. The 12 gates have come up in Bristel Goodman before.
